Abstract
This scholarly article presents an analytical study of the history of Urdu literature, examining its evolution, major literary movements, and influential writers over the centuries. The study highlights the impact of cultural, political, and social factors on the development of Urdu literature and its various genres, from classical poetry to modern prose. The article discusses significant milestones in Urdu literary history, including the contributions of notable poets and prose writers. Additionally, it emphasizes the importance of understanding the historical context for a comprehensive appreciation of the Urdu literary tradition.
